Patent number: 12260462Abstract: Techniques for real-time expense auditing and machine learning are disclosed. An expense auditing system trains a machine learning model to compute audit risk scores as a function of expense descriptions. The auditing system receives an expense description associated with an employee. The expense auditing system computes, using the trained machine learning model, an audit risk score associated with the expense description. The expense auditing system compares the audit risk score with an audit trigger. The audit trigger includes one or more conditions that, when satisfied, identifies expense descriptions that are at risk of being audited. The expense auditing system determines that the audit risk score satisfies the audit trigger. Responsive to determining that the audit risk score satisfies the audit trigger, the expense auditing system alerts the employee that the expense description is at risk of being audited.Type: GrantFiled: September 10, 2020Date of Patent: March 25, 2025Assignee: Oracle International CorporationInventors: Winston Leonard Wang, Parker Ralph Kuncl, Kelly Bailey, Matthew Brigante

Patent number: 12254461Abstract: Methods, systems, and apparatuses are described herein for generating and managing virtual transaction cards based on mobile device location so as to provide transaction security during in-person transactions. A geographic location of a mobile device may be determined, a proximate merchant may be selected, and a virtual transaction card may be generated for that particular merchant. Data corresponding to that virtual transaction card may be deployed into a digital wallet device for use during transactions with point-of-sale devices. Use of the digital wallet device may be conditioned on geographic location, time, an unlock command from a mobile device, or the like. By providing such dynamically-generated and limited virtual transaction cards for in-person transactions, the threat of security vulnerabilities relating to point-of-sale systems may be mitigated.Type: GrantFiled: November 30, 2022Date of Patent: March 18, 2025Assignee: Capital One Services, LLCInventors: Mohak Chadha, Allison Fenichel

Patent number: 12243047Abstract: Provided are a re-using e-commerce payment instruments for in-store purchasing systems and methods. A customer enters a check out and a transaction at the point of sale is started. The system receives a pairing request at a wallet processor from a customer mobile device operating a mobile application. This pairing request is created and sent in response to scanning of a code having a transaction identification. The system associates a customer payment profile with the transaction identification and sends associated information to the point of sale. The point of sale sends an amount of sale to authorize to the wallet processor after completing scanning of items. The system creates an authorization for payment and sending the authorization for payment to an authorizer. The transaction may then be completed by processing payment.Type: GrantFiled: January 20, 2023Date of Patent: March 4, 2025Assignee: Walmart Apollo, LLCInventors: Bradley Joseph Kieffer, Mark Matthews, Eytan Daniyalzade, David Martin Nelms, Prasanna Rajendran, Charles David Berry, Daniel Eckert

Patent number: 12223466Abstract: Cameras capture images of shelves/displays having items. The images are processed to identify real-time item counts on the shelves and/or empty or partially empty shelves with less than a configured number of items. Notifications or messages regarding item counts and/or empty shelving conditions are sent through an Application Programming Interface (API) to consuming services in accordance with custom defined rules. In an embodiment, real-time item counts and/or empty shelving conditions are dynamically reported through the API based on on-demand requests from the consuming services.Type: GrantFiled: September 27, 2019Date of Patent: February 11, 2025Assignee: NCR Voyix CorporationInventors: Qian Yang, Frank Douglas Hinek, Brent Vance Zucker
